About The White Swan

The White Swan offers guests three centuries of history. It got its start as a coaching inn and still accommodates travellers who need a comfortable, reliable option. All rooms have en suite accommodations with either bathtubs or showers. Complimentary toiletries are provided. Rooms have work desks, plus complimentary Wi-Fi access and televisions. Coffee and tea making facilities are available as well. Free parking is provided for guests of The White Swan. It’s also possible to reserve the property’s event spaces for private functions. Dining choices are offered at Hardy’s Bistro or The Olympic Suite Restaurant, which is decorated with original materials from the Titanic’s sister ship. Furthermore, guests can avail of afternoon tea. Alnwick Castle is accessible on foot within a few minutes of the hotel. Additionally, it’s easy to get to the stunning natural beauty of Northumberland National Park.

Review summary

This AI-generated summary was based on reviews from multiple 
sites

The hotel offers a distinctive experience, largely defined by its historic Olympic dining room, a unique feature salvaged from the sister ship of the Titanic. This grand and opulent space is a consistent highlight, drawing in history enthusiasts and those seeking a memorable atmosphere. The hotel's central location is also a significant advantage, making it an excellent base for sightseers and tourists eager to explore nearby attractions. While many guests appreciate the hotel's character and the generally friendly staff, some rooms are noted as being dated, and the evening dining experience can be inconsistent. Dog owners will find the hotel particularly welcoming, with dedicated services for pets. To ensure the best experience, guests might consider inquiring about recently refurbished rooms and managing expectations regarding the evening meal, which some find to be more suited for large groups than fine dining.


Facilities & Amenities
The hotel, housed in an older building, presents a mix of traditional charm and some practical considerations. A frequently noted point is the absence of a lift, which can pose a challenge for guests with mobility issues or those carrying heavy luggage, as there are numerous stairs and steps throughout the property. Parking is available, often free, though spaces at the hotel can be limited, necessitating the use of nearby public car parks. While Wi-Fi is generally offered, some guests have reported connectivity issues in certain rooms. The hotel features a pleasant bar and bistro area, and rooms are typically equipped with tea and coffee making facilities, often including complimentary cookies or bottles of water. Heating can be inconsistent, with some rooms being too cold and others having overly powerful radiators, and bathroom heating is a common concern.


Cleanliness & Room Comfort
Feedback on room cleanliness and comfort is varied. Many guests describe their rooms as clean and comfortable, with some praising the spacious layouts and comfortable beds. However, a significant number of reviews indicate that rooms are often tired, dated, and in need of refurbishment, with observations of worn furnishings, stains, or general wear and tear. The bathroom areas frequently receive criticism for being dated, having issues like mould, dirty grout, worn enamel in baths, loose taps, or poor drainage. Some bathrooms also lack adequate heating or proper ventilation. Noise levels can be a concern, with reports of street noise, traffic noise, or sounds from neighboring rooms impacting sleep. While some rooms offer amenities like slippers and robes, the overall impression of room condition is mixed.


Dining & Food Quality
The hotel's Olympic Dining Room is consistently lauded for its stunning, historic ambiance, providing a unique backdrop for meals. Breakfast generally receives positive feedback, described as plentiful with a good buffet selection, including hot options and fresh fruit. However, some guests note issues with food being served cold, undercooked items, or limited variety, such as the absence of certain egg preparations or hash browns. The evening meals, particularly in the Olympic restaurant, elicit mixed to negative reviews. While some guests find the food good or delicious, many describe it as average, disappointing, bland, or of a mass-produced quality, with limited menu choices and inconsistent preparation of vegetables or main courses. The bar and bistro food also receive varied comments, ranging from tasty and good value to unappetizing.


Location & Accessibility
The hotel's central location is a major highlight, consistently praised for its convenience. Guests find it ideally situated within easy walking distance of key attractions such as Alnwick Castle, the Alnwick Gardens, and the town's marketplace, shops, and pubs. This makes it an excellent base for exploring the local area and beyond, including other regional landmarks. Parking is available at the hotel, often free, though spaces can be limited, leading some guests to utilize nearby public car parks. Despite its prime location, the hotel presents significant accessibility challenges. The absence of a lift and the presence of numerous stairs and steps throughout the building make it difficult for guests with mobility impairments, those with heavy luggage, or families with pushchairs.


Staff & Service
The hotel's staff consistently receives high praise, being described as overwhelmingly friendly, helpful, attentive, and welcoming. Guests frequently highlight their efficiency during check-in and check-out processes, and their willingness to accommodate requests, such as early check-ins or room changes. The pet-friendly service is particularly commended, with staff going out of their way to ensure comfort for animal companions. While most interactions are positive, some minor inconsistencies are noted, such as occasional unserviced rooms by housekeeping or a perceived lack of attentiveness in certain dining situations. Overall, the staff's dedication to providing a positive guest experience is a recurring theme, contributing significantly to guest satisfaction.


Additional Information
The hotel maintains a no cash policy, operating exclusively with card payments, which some guests find inconvenient. A notable point of contention for some is the practice of automatically adding service charges or gratuities to bills, including for drinks, which can lead to confusion or frustration if not clearly communicated. The hotel is highly pet-friendly, offering specific amenities and services for dogs, though some rooms require access via an outdoor courtyard. It is a popular choice for coach trips and also serves as a wedding venue. Guests should be aware that some rooms may experience Wi-Fi issues, and the hotel sometimes implements timed breakfast slots. The property's historical connections as an old coaching house add to its unique character, beyond just the famous dining room.
